データサイエンティストハトリのブログ

PythonとインテリジェントクラウドとAIが好きな学生エンジニア。データ分析、スクレイピング、就職活動などについて書いていきます。

【Python】環境構築がわからない人は入れたり消して全部リセットしまくる練習がおすすめ!

f:id:hatorihatorihatorik:20180917043934p:plain

環境構築ってかなり難しいですよね。プログラミング初心者の方はかなりここで苦しんでいるイメージを受けます。

特にPythonはAnaconda, pip, pyenvなど、初心者にはわけのわからない単語が並びまくりエラーが出た瞬間におわります。

 

環境構築は全体感を把握するのが必要

環境構築には全体感を把握する必要があります。全体的にそれぞれのツールがどんな仕事をこなしており、このコマンドを打つとこう言う風にできる。といったような感じです。

 

このためにはとにかくたくさんコマンドを打ち込みまくって環境を作って行く練習をするのがおすすめです!!

 

Pythonの消し方

pythonがどのファイルに入っているか調べます。

 

 

$ which python

 

ファイルの場所がわかったら削除です。

 

最後に/usr/local/bin にある /Library/Frameworks/Python.framework へのシンボリックリンクを削除します。

 

$ ll /usr/local/bin | grep Python | xargs rm -r

 </

$ sudo rm -rf <ファイルの場所>

 

pyenvの消し方

$ which pyenv

 

該当箇所に移動します。

 

$ rm -rf .pyenv/

 

完了です。